Found 3 matching private schools in Berlin, Vermont

Choose an option below to narrow your search..

Center School Montessori
There are 19 students enrolled at Center School Montessori
Central Vermont Catholic School-St Michael Campus
There are 102 students enrolled at Central Vermont Catholic School-St Michael Campus
The New School of Montpelier
There are 20 students enrolled at The New School of Montpelier